Latest Urban Flight of Fancy: Miami Flamingos
- Share via
Remember the cows grazing the streets of downtown Chicago in bovine incongruity a few years ago? Now Miami Beach, frothy repository of seaside style, is to parade its own street art: sidewalk sculptures of flamingos.
Chicago did the fiberglass cows in 1999, and there were more bovines in New York and Houston, moose in Toronto and pigs in Cincinnati the next year. Miami Beach’s own sidewalk animal show will aim to place about 100 8-foot-tall flamingo sculptures throughout the South Florida city from May until October, city officials said.
